Grok app now supports Vision, answering questions about what the camera sees

by Wire Tech

xAI’s Grok chatbot now features Grok Vision, allowing users to point their iPhone camera at objects—like products, signs, or documents—and ask questions about what they see, similar to real-time vision tools from ChatGPT and Google Gemini. Grok Vision is currently available only on iOS.

Alongside Grok Vision, xAI rolled out new features including multilingual audio and real-time search in voice mode. These are available to Android users subscribed to the $30/month SuperGrok plan.

Grok has been steadily evolving. Earlier this month, xAI introduced a memory feature for recalling past conversations and a canvas tool for building documents and apps.
